LinuxSir.cn,穿越时空的Linuxsir!

 找回密码
 注册
搜索
热搜: shell linux mysql
查看: 2084|回复: 6

内核的格式?

[复制链接]
发表于 2003-2-11 21:24:40 | 显示全部楼层 |阅读模式
编译后的内核有压缩,但有的叫bzImage,有的是vmImage,据说格式还不一样,哪位大哥能告知详情,谢谢!
发表于 2003-2-12 08:47:51 | 显示全部楼层
用make zImage和make bzImage生成的核心都是压缩过的。不同之处只是bzImage能处理较大的核心。
发表于 2003-2-13 21:01:13 | 显示全部楼层
用 file 命令 ,如
file bzImage
 楼主| 发表于 2003-2-17 14:35:25 | 显示全部楼层
众大哥可不可以说详细点呢?比如共有几种格式,优缺点,如何Make等。
发表于 2003-3-11 11:11:31 | 显示全部楼层

两种压缩格式

zImage 用 gzip 压缩
bzImage 用 bzip2 压缩
bzip2压缩率比 gzip 高一点点,但速度慢不少
当你编译好内核后,无论是zImage还是bzImage,如果你要使用他,需要把他复制到/boot路径下,并且改名为 vmlinuz-x.x.x (x.x.x为版本号),为什么要改名,i don't know, 也许内核开发人员可以回答
发表于 2003-3-11 13:28:09 | 显示全部楼层
没必要改名字的,那只是为了方便不同内核启动,因为这样总比叫bzImage0,bzImage1直观一些
发表于 2003-3-11 22:29:29 | 显示全部楼层
对的,只是区别期间而用的,其实用vmlinux也可以的。
您需要登录后才可以回帖 登录 | 注册

本版积分规则

快速回复 返回顶部 返回列表